Trauma isn’t always loud. It can appear in subtle emotional, psychological, and physical ways, often rooted in “quiet” experiences like chronic stress or feeling overwhelmed. It may show up as anxiety, hypervigilance, emotional numbness, difficulty with trust or boundaries, perfectionism, people-pleasing, low self-worth, or avoidance. The body can react too, with chronic tension, headaches, digestive issues, fatigue, sleep problems, or heightened responses to stress. When these feelings build, it’s important to pause, breathe, and seek support. Understanding that everyone experiences these feelings at some point can help us navigate through difficulties with greater empathy and compassion for ourselves.
